What can you tell me about the surf conditions at the nearby Clifton Beach?
Clifton Beach faces south‑southeast into Storm Bay, with waves averaging 1‑1.5 m that create a moderately steep, barreling beach. It is considered one of the most dangerous Tasmanian beaches due to its powerful swells and frequent rips.
How far is Clifton Beach from Hobart?
Clifton Beach lies roughly 25 km southeast of Hobart, positioned on the South Arm Peninsula in the City of Clarence.
Is there a surf life‑saving club nearby?
Yes, the Clifton Beach Surf Life Saving Club, established in 1963, operates close to the property and provides summer patrols, a 24/7 emergency response team, and community programs such as the nippers.
